About this property

Creekside Retreat Treehouse In Cooksmills, 15 minutes from Niagara Falls

Welcome to this charming treehouse in the quaint village of Cooks Mills with a view of Lyons Creek from your private deck. This superb property offers a cozy loft bedroom with a queen sized bed, equipped with window AC, dart board ,mini fridge , microwave, keurig machine , TV , BBQ on deck and firepit on lawn .The bathroom is clean and well-maintained. Guests can relax and unwind in this tremendous space, surrounded by nature's beauty and views from your private deck of Lyons Creek . About the neighborhood

Niagara Falls

Located in Niagara Falls, this cabin is in a rural area and on the waterfront. Skylon Tower and Rainbow Bridge are notable landmarks, and some of the area's popular attractions include Fallsview Indoor Waterpark and Maid of the Mist. Waves Indoor Waterpark and Niagara Freefall & Interactive Center are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with kayaking and fishing n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ails and cycling.

What makes this property unique

The war of 1812 occurred in this area and has monuments and plaques around Cookmills with information about the war

There's horse across from our home , very nice to see them on our walks
